La Mother Church of Maria Santissima Assunta in Adrano is located in Piazza Umberto, adjacent to Via Giuseppe Garibaldi and immediately presents itself as a place of worship that impresses the eye for its majesty; a more in-depth visit also reveals numerous traces of the passage of history in this land, come on Norman conquerors of the year XNUMX, to the Sicilians of the eighteenth century, also testifying to the advent of natural phenomena, such as the earthquake, which the church resisted.

Adrano is located in the Metropolitan City of Catania, in Sicily, and the Church of Maria Ss. Assunta is one of the architectural beauties that can be admired there.

The original church, built in the Norman era, was built near the Defense Tower in Piazza Umberto, according to the use of this people but, over the centuries, there have been numerous renovation and expansion interventions, which have brought the building to its present appearance. Where today you can admire the Mother Church of Adrano, perhaps a smaller and older church once stood, presumably incorporated into the new construction.

Next to the church there is the base of a bell tower, the construction of which began in the last century and which was then demolished at the end of the XNUMXs.

The architecture and works of art of the Mother Church of Adrano

The ancient and original structure of the church was very simple, formed by a single nave and without chapels and apse. Later, towards the end of the XNUMXth century, a first extension was arranged from Duke of Moncada, who had the nave enlarged and two side chapels added, as well as the apse area. Instead, the large brick dome was built in the eighteenth century. Finally, the plan of the church assumed the shape of the Latin cross.

A feature that immediately strikes visitors, even before entering the central nave, is the area that gives access to the church itself: it is in fact made up of three open-air entrances, delimited by columns and lava stone, corresponding to the three internal naves.

On the facade there is the niche that contains the statue of Virgin of the Assumption, to which the church is dedicated.

The facade therefore appears mysterious and fascinating, with a mixture of styles, from the mighty Norman to the most sought after Barocco of some of the friezes.

Inside the sacred building it is possible to admire the colonnade as well as numerous statues, paintings and frescoes by Spanish artists, but also Italian ones, such as the Repentance of Magdalene and The Appearance of Jesus to Blessed Alacoque, by Giuseppe Guzzardi, born in Adrano around the middle of the XNUMXth century.

The scenes represented in the canvases on display are surrounded by splendid gilded frames, while it is also possible to admire wooden works, namely the Cantoria, where the musical instruments of the church are kept, such as the organ.

How to get to the Church of Maria Santissima Assunta in Adrano

In the province of Catania, Adrano can be easily reached by motorway, for those who want to travel by car: take the A18 Messina-Catania with exits at Acireale or Giarre (just under 30 km from the centre), or the A19 Palermo -Catania, exit at Catenanuova or Sferro-Gerbini (less than 20 km from Adrano).

Those who prefer to travel by train can get off at Catania Central Station, and then continue by public bus or private shuttle to their destination, for a distance of about 30 km.
